I'm using compiz-fusion/gnome/nvidia driver and if I suspend the machine while logged into Gnome, I am presented with a totally white screen (no mouse cursor) when the machine is awoken from suspend mode. I usually do a ctlr+alt+backspace and the reload of gdm fixes the problem. If I log out first and then place the machine into suspend mode from the Gnome login screen, it resumes just fine wo/ a white screen. I'm thinking the problem lies in compiz-fusion somehow.
